On Saturday, the Sandhills/Thedford Knights came up short against the West Holt Huskies and fell 2-0. The Knights have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
While Sandhills/Thedford ultimately came up short, they didn't go down without a fight: they scored at least 17 points in every set they played.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-19, 25-17.
Sandhills/Thedford's defeat dropped their record down to 14-10. As for West Holt, their victory bumped their record up to 17-8.
Sandhills/Thedford will be staying on the road on Thursday to face off against Arthur County at 9:00 p.m. Sandhills/Thedford is facing Arthur County at the right time seeing as Arthur County is stuck on a four-game losing streak. As for West Holt, they will welcome North Central on Thursday.
